Arthur Scott Bailey (1877 – 1949) was a prolific author of over forty childrens books, captivating young readers with his imaginative tales. The Newark Evening News praised his unique storytelling style, noting that he skillfully centered his plots around the enchanting worlds of animals, birds, and insects. By seamlessly weaving natural history into his narratives, Bailey earned the approval of educators while never compromising the intrigue for his young audience. He believed in challenging children with a rich vocabulary, understanding that they respond positively to the thrill of the unfamiliar.
